
Devon Peak and Modoc Peak anchor the high elevations of the Mountain Boy Range in this modern topographic survey of Eureka County. The landscape is defined by the high-desert transition from the Mahogany Hills and Whistler Range into the broad basin of Diamond Valley. This valley floor serves as a local aviation hub, marked by the Eureka Airport and an emerging residential street grid featuring names like El Rancho St and Frontier St.
